Найти тему
Tehnichka.pro

Как пользоваться Putty

Оглавление

Рассказываем об утилите для настройки SSH-подключения.

Что такое Putty?

Linux — самая востребованная платформа для серверов. Исторически сложилось, что в операционных системах на базе Linux намного больше утилит и программ, пригодных для работы с серверами, включая дистанционное управление.

В Linux поддерживается технология SSH, с помощью которой можно удаленно управлять любым компьютером. Она очень устойчива и достаточно безопасна, чтобы стать неким стандартом в индустрии. Она и стала.

Суть SSH проста. Если подключиться по этому протоколу к компьютеру, то вам полностью переходит управления над ним. Через терминал можно выполнять любые команды на удаленном компьютере будто на своем. Часто SSH используют для дистанционного управления серверами. На их основе строят веб-сайты и различные веб-сервисы.

А вот Windows по умолчанию не умеет работать с протоколом SSH (платформа Microsoft вообще слабо приспособлена к программированию в некоторых аспектах), но есть сторонняя программа, которая эту поддержку обеспечивает. Это Putty.

Устанавливаем Putty в Windows

  • Заходим на официальный сайт программы Putty.
  • Кликаем по ссылке here в строке You can download PuTTY.
Загружаем клиент Putty
Загружаем клиент Putty
  • Выбираем версию Putty, подходящую вам по разрядности системы.
Можно скачать по FTP
Можно скачать по FTP
  • Запускаем установочный файл.
  • Жмем Next.
Тут все просто, жмем Next
Тут все просто, жмем Next
  • Выбираем папку для установки.
Обычно все оставляют стандартный путь
Обычно все оставляют стандартный путь
  • Ждем, пока не появится запрос от системы разрешить установку Putty, и принимаем его.
Возможно потребуется ввести пароль администратора
Возможно потребуется ввести пароль администратора
  • В конце установки снимаем галочку с пункта View README File и нажимаем Finish.
Нам файл README не нужен
Нам файл README не нужен

Установка Putty в Linux

Тут все просто. Чтобы установить Putty в системы на базе Debian (Ubuntu, Mint и др.), нужно ввести в терминал следующие команды:

sudo apt update

sudo apt install putty

После установки утилита будет готова к использованию.

Запускаем Putty

В системах Linux следует найти программу в списке приложений и открыть ее. Если вы используете систему Windows, то путь будет следующим:

  • Кликаем по поисковому полю Windows.
Ищем программу, если не создали ярлык на рабочем столе
Ищем программу, если не создали ярлык на рабочем столе
  • Затем выбираем в списке установленную программу Putty.
Можно запустить ее нажатием клавиши «Ввод» (Enter)
Можно запустить ее нажатием клавиши «Ввод» (Enter)

Настройка Putty

В открывшемся окне вы увидите список настроек, который делится на 4 основных категории:

  • Настройки сессии. Здесь указываются данные сервера, к которому мы будем подключаться.
  • Настройки терминала. Здесь настраиваются сочетания клавиш, действующие в терминале и некоторые дополнительные функции.
  • Настройки окна. Здесь настраивается внешний вид программы.
  • Настройки подключения. Здесь можно указать параметры SSH и Proxy.

Подключение к серверу через Putty

Переходим в блок настроек Session. Вводим данные сервера:

  • Имя хоста (Host Name). Также сюда можно ввести IP-адрес.
  • Порт. По умолчанию установлен порт 22.
  • Тип подключения SSH.
Данные для подключения можно узнать у провайдера удаленного сервера
Данные для подключения можно узнать у провайдера удаленного сервера
  • Затем нажимаем на кнопку Open, чтобы запустить SSH-сессию.
Предупреждение при первом запуске Putty
Предупреждение при первом запуске Putty
  • Сразу после начала сессии должен открыться терминал с просьбой указать логин и пароль для подключения по SSH:Вводим свой логин в поле login as:.
    Затем вводим пароль в поле Password:.
Учтите, что при вводе пароля в терминале, он никак не отображается. Вы не увидите вообще никаких знаков, поэтому пароль нужно вводить аккуратно вслепую, игнорируя пустоту.
  • После этого терминал выдаст сообщение в духе: The programs included with the Debian GNU/Linux system are free software; the exact distribution terms for each program are described in the individual files in /usr/share/doc/*/copyright. Debian GNU/Linux comes with ABSOLUTELY NO WARRANTY, to the extent permitted by applicable law. example.com@n11:$

С этого момент можно начинать управлять своим сервером дистанционно, выполняя те же команды, что вы привыкли выполнять в Linux.

Полезные опции

Чтобы каждый раз не вводить параметры заново, можно сохранить настройки и переиспользовать их при следующем запуске программы. Для этого:

  • Открываем окно Session.
  • Вводим название сохраненных настроек в строчку Saved Sessions.
  • Нажимаем на кнопку Save.
Список сохранений не ограничен
Список сохранений не ограничен

При следующем запуске Putty можно выбрать сохраненные настройки, выделив их название в списке и нажав на кнопку Load.

Свою жизнь можно сделать еще легче, указав имя пользователя, которое будет автоматически вводиться в терминал при подключении. Для этого:

  • Открываем блок настроек Connection.
  • Переходим в пункт Data.
  • Ищем поле Auto-login Username и вводим туда имя пользователя.

Теперь для подключения к серверу остается ввести только пароль.

Автор материала: Владимир Ковылов

Подписывайтесь на наш канал и ставьте лайки! А еще можете посетить наш официальный сайт.